Coffee Shops in Downtown Las Vegas
Donut Bar
Donut Bar, one of the most awarded donut shops in the USA, has been recognized by various publications including USA Today and Thrillist.com. Customers can indulge in a variety of doughnut flavors while sipping on coffee.
PublicUs
Located on Fremont Street, PublicUs is a neighborhood restaurant and coffee bar that offers New American cuisine for breakfast and brunch. The canteen-style setup makes it a great spot for a casual meal.
AmeriBrunch Cafe
AmeriBrunch Cafe is an American restaurant and coffee shop located in the heart of Las Vegas that serves freshly brewed coffee and delicious breakfast and lunch items.
Vesta Coffee Roasters
Vesta Coffee Roasters is a cafe in Downtown Vegas that is known for their freshly roasted coffee. They also serve food and their products are available at Whole Foods and Sprouts.

One highly recommended coffee shop is PublicUs. This hip and trendy spot offers delicious coffee and an array of gourmet food options. Locals love the cozy atmosphere and friendly staff. Tourists rave about the avocado toast and homemade pastries. Prices at PublicUs are reasonable, with a cup of coffee starting at $3.
Another popular spot is Mothership Coffee Roasters. This minimalist cafe serves up high-quality coffee beans roasted in-house. The atmosphere is laid-back, making it a great place to relax and enjoy your beverage. Locals appreciate the unique blends of coffee, while tourists love the Instagram-worthy latte art. Prices at Mothership are slightly higher, with a cup of coffee starting at $4.
For those looking for a more traditional coffeehouse experience, The Beat Coffeehouse is a must-visit. The quirky decor and live music make this spot a favorite among locals and tourists alike. The menu features classic coffee drinks and tasty breakfast options. Prices at The Beat are affordable, with a cup of coffee starting at $2.
